摘要: Java常用类 一、Object类 getClass()方法 public final Class<?> getClass() { } 返回引用中存储的实际对象类型 应用:通常判断两个引用中实际对象类型是否一致 hashCode()方法 public int hashCode() { } 返回该对象 阅读全文
posted @ 2022-09-14 16:57 gcbeen 阅读(29) 评论(0) 推荐(0)
摘要: 内部类 内部类就是在一个类的内部在定义一个类,比如,A类中定义一个B类,那么B类相对A类来说就称为内部类,而A类相对B类来说就是外部类了。 成员内部类 静态内部类 局部内部类 匿名内部类 public class Outer { private int id = 10; public void ou 阅读全文
posted @ 2022-09-14 16:56 gcbeen 阅读(20) 评论(0) 推荐(0)
摘要: 抽象类和接口 抽象类 抽象方法只有方法的声明没有方法的实现。让子类来实现 有抽象方法的类一定要声明为抽象类 不能使用 new 关键字来创建对象。它是用来让子类继承的 注意:抽象类中可以没有抽象方法 public abstract class Action { public abstract void 阅读全文
posted @ 2022-09-14 16:40 gcbeen 阅读(34) 评论(0) 推荐(0)
摘要: 面向对象三大特性 封装:属性私有,get/set 把内部数据操作细节封起来不允许外部干涉。仅暴露少量的方法给外部使用 数据操作细节封起来叫:高内聚 仅暴露少量的方法给外部叫:低耦合 暴露的方法叫:操作接口 package com.gcbeen.oop; public class Student { 阅读全文
posted @ 2022-09-14 16:24 gcbeen 阅读(33) 评论(0) 推荐(0)
摘要: 面向对象 一、初识面向对象 举例 Math 类 public final class Math { private Math() { } public static final double E = 2.7182818284590452354; public static final double 阅读全文
posted @ 2022-09-12 16:15 gcbeen 阅读(27) 评论(0) 推荐(0)
摘要: 方法的定义与调用 方法的定义 修饰符 返回类型 break:跳出 switch,结束循环和 return的区别。 方法名:注意规范,见名知意 参数列表:(参数类型,参数名) … 异常抛出 package com.gcbeen.oop; import java.io.IOException; /** 阅读全文
posted @ 2022-09-12 15:32 gcbeen 阅读(29) 评论(0) 推荐(0)
摘要: 数组的应用 1.Arrays类 数组的工具类 javautil. Arrays 数组本身并没有什么方法可以供我们调用。但API中提供了一个工具类 Arrays 可以对数据对象进行一些基本的操作。 查看JDK帮助文档。 Arrays类中的方法都是 static 修饰的静态方法在使用的时候可以直接使用类 阅读全文
posted @ 2022-09-11 16:05 gcbeen 阅读(56) 评论(0) 推荐(0)
摘要: 数组 1.数组概述 数组是相同类型数据的有序集合。 数组描述的是相同类型的若干个数据按照一定的先后次序排列组合而成。 其中每一个数据称作一个数组元素每个数组元素可以通过一个下标来访问它们。 2.数组声明创建 首先必须声明数组变量,才能在程序中使用数组。下面是声明数组变量的语法: dataType[] 阅读全文
posted @ 2022-09-11 15:14 gcbeen 阅读(42) 评论(0) 推荐(0)
摘要: 方法-参数传递 参数传递:值传递 传递基本数据类型时:把实参的值传递给形参 package com.gcbeen.method; /** * @author gcbeen * */ public class HomeWork01 { private static int x = 10; public 阅读全文
posted @ 2022-09-11 11:15 gcbeen 阅读(45) 评论(0) 推荐(0)
摘要: 流程控制-break& continue break break在任何循环语句的主体部分,均可用 break控制循环的流程。 break用于强行退出循环,不执行循环中剩余的语句。( break语句也在 switch语句中使用)。 continue continue语句用在循环语句体中,用于终止某次循 阅读全文
posted @ 2022-09-09 09:54 gcbeen 阅读(43) 评论(0) 推荐(0)